De voortzetting

Na de epic fail vandaag is het verstandig om maar eens een plan te maken om GPS geleide vluchten wel ‘foutloos’ te kunnen maken. Al eerder had Rubke het idee om een parcour op te zetten. Dit weekend zit ik in Friesland bij de heren van Vrijschrift en Big Wobber al daar is wat meer gras (ook meer wind) en daar eens te kijken of vliegen op enkel de GPS een optie is die beter werkt.

Er is tevens een failsafe die ik nog nooit heb geprobeerd. Je kunt de Mikrokopter direct terug naar huis laten vliegen, wat de start positie is van de vlucht. Wellicht ook weer een leer momentje.

Vliegen in de wind

Vandaag scheen de zon, dus ik dacht tussen de middag al eens om te gaan vliegen. Echter de wind was fors. Bij het vlucht voorbereiden kwam ik er achter dat ik net als Rubke wat kwijt was. De vertrager om de camera horizontaal stabiel te houden was weg. Na wat speurwerk in de tuin hebben we het stukje plastic toch gevonden. En gaan we maar eens bedenken hoe dit beter te verlijmen is.

Om toch even een foto van de dag te hebben, de tuin van de buren ;)

Vliegen met wat wind

Vliegen met wat wind

Ik was ook even naar een parkje geweest met lieve kleine eendjes enzo, maar toen ik eenmaal in de lucht was zei de batterij toedels, gezien dat daar ook wat wind stond en m’n copter op het einde lag gras te maaien had ik maar besloten naar huis te gaan.

Data samenvoegen met Hudgin en Bundler

Hugin is een grafische applicatie voor panotools, en kan gebruik maken van wat technieken zoals sift om afbeeldingen op elkaar op te lijnen. In principe maak het gebruik van een aantal overeenkomstige punten op een foto waarna verschillende foto’s op elkaar worden gelegd. Dat gaat bijzonder goed als de foto’s van hetzelfde punt af zijn genomen maar niet zo goed of zelfs slecht met foto’s die vanaf willekeurige posities zijn genomen en onder andere hoeken.

Na wat handmatige hulp kwam ik op het volgende plaatje uit door middel van de Enblend render tool.

De uitvoer die Enblend maakt

De uitvoer die Enblend maakt

Er zitten duidelijke artefacten in op de randen van de afbeelding, dat kan komen door te weinig overlap.

Uiteraard ben ik ook met bundler aan de slag geweest… de uitvoer in Blender is nog verre van productie klaar, dus dat wordt de komende weken nog even pielen om mooie samengesmolten 3D plaatjes te krijgen.

De point cloud die uit Bundler komt

De point cloud die uit Bundler komt

Gehaktdag

Vorige week donderdag hebben Rubke en ik naast lekker Chinees gegeten ook gewerkt aan de twee Quadkopters. We zijn in Limburg op pad geweest om twee voeding stekkertjes voor onze nieuwe camera’s, de stekkertjes aan een kabeltje verbonden en getest of de camera’s met 5V om kunnen gaan. Naast wat software upgrades is de tweede QC met de voorlopige code name “C|_” afgebouwd en per nachttransport richting Leidschendam gekomen.

Om goed te kunnen vliegen moeten er met een Mikrokopter een aantal dingen gebeuren, zoals het kalibreren van het gyroscopisch kompas. Al een paar dagen ben ik nu ‘s nachts in de tuin en loop ik rond met een quadcopter op m’n vinger en een R/C op m’n buik. Het vliegen is nog niet eenvoudig en daardoor heb ik me al gewend tot de configuratie suite van de quadkopter die je in staat stelt om de besturing minder fel te laten reageren en zo wat meer gevoel te krijgen voor het vliegen. Het is maar goed dat ik op het gras aan het oefenen ben, na twee keer geprobeerd gewoon te landen, blijkt dat toch niet zo’n succes. Na nu een paar dagen oefenen merk je wel dat met wat voorzichtig proberen je minder schrikt en dus minder fel reageert en ik misschien deze week verder moet gaan en naar het parkje hier op de hoek moet, daar is een groter grasveldje.

In dit weekend heb ik eerst eens gekeken naar de software die beschikbaar was voor Linux, een leuk QMK-GroundControll programma geeft je onder Linux de mogelijkheid parameters in te stellen. Met kvm/qemu is het natuurlijk ook mogelijk om via kvm -serial /dev/ttyUS0 de boel door te lussen in Windows. Je moet alleen even zorgen dat je geen last hebt van Mickeysoft Ballpoint Seriele Muizen, funest voor je Windows Experience ;)

Op hardware gebied ben ik vooral bezig geweest met bluetooth, op een of andere manier komt niet hetzelfde signaal door de Linux bluetooth stack (Bluez met RFCOM) en de ‘normale’ USB verbinding, dat zou niet moeten gebeuren. Mede daarom heb ik vandaag de software geupgrade, naar de allerlaatste versie, maar dat mocht ook niet baten. Rest mij dus alleen nog eens een protocol analyse te doen, immers iets moet er toch iets anders met het signaal gebeuren?